Developer Portal APIs and Controllers for Kubernetes-based API management.
The Developer Portal Controller provides Kubernetes Custom Resource Definitions (CRDs) for managing API products and API keys in a developer portal ecosystem. It integrates with Kuadrant and Gateway API to provide a complete API lifecycle management solution.
The APIProduct resource represents an API offering in the developer portal. It references an HTTPRoute and can include documentation, contact information, and usage plans.

The APIKeyRequest resource is a shadow resource automatically created by the Developer Portal Controller in the API owner's namespace whenever a consumer creates an APIKey. This design enables namespace-based RBAC: API owners can list and review access requests for their API products without requiring cluster-wide permissions to view all APIKeys across all consumer namespaces.
Key characteristics:
- Created automatically by the controller (not by users)
- Lives in the API owner's namespace
- Contains request metadata (use case, requester info, plan tier)
- Does NOT contain the API key secret value (preserves consumer data isolation)
- Serves as the basis for approval/denial decisions

The APIKeyApproval resource represents an API owner's decision to approve or deny an APIKeyRequest. API owners create this resource in their own namespace to review and make decisions on API access requests for their API products.
Key characteristics:
- Created by API owners (manual approval mode) or automatically (automatic mode)
- Lives in the API owner's namespace (same as the APIProduct)
- Contains approval decision and reviewer metadata
- Controller validates that the APIKeyApproval namespace matches the APIProduct namespace to prevent cross-namespace approval attacks

Key Concepts:
- Namespace Isolation: Consumer resources (APIKey) are isolated in the consumer's namespace; owner resources (APIProduct, APIKeyRequest, APIKeyApproval) are in the owner's namespace
- Cross-Namespace References (solid arrows): Enable consumers to request access to APIs owned by others
- Local References (solid arrows): Keep owner-side resources scoped within the owner's namespace
- Controller Actions (dashed arrows): Automated creation and updates by the Developer Portal Controller
- Shadow Resource Pattern: APIKeyRequest mirrors APIKey metadata in the owner's namespace without exposing sensitive data

If the APIProduct has approvalMode: automatic, the controller automatically creates an APIKeyApproval resource with approved: true when the APIKeyRequest is created, skipping the manual review step.
